Transaction 91e4cc12073f51cd32ef151926a3e682a5277dd277b34e35ffb5f7cf5b6f74a3
1 Input
1 Output
-
91e4cc12073f51cd32ef151926a3e682a5277dd277b34e35ffb5f7cf5b6f74a3:0
- value
- 1977809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16973048032c103aa9fe43e84c25a818dabe1fb2 OP_EQUAL
- address
- 33kTuXp183YQg2jax6uz2jpWUZvBwHY2bM